If `a_(1), a_(2),…, a_(n +1)` are in A.P., then `(1)/(a_(1)a_(2)) + (1)/(a_(2)a_(3)) +...+ (1)/(a_(n) a_(n + 1))` is

A

`(n - 1)/(a_(1) a_(n + 1))`

B

`(n + 1)/(a_(1) a_(n + 1))`

C

`(1)/(a_(1) a_(n + 1))`

D

`(n)/(a_(1) a_(n + 1))`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D
